What's OTG 

Simply put, OTG stands for “ On- the- Go. ” It’s a mode available on numerous mobile bias that allows them to power and communicate with USB accessories. OTG appendages can connect mobile bias to Ethernet and colorful USB peripherals. 

The Charge- Plus LAN mecca, for illustration, is a USB- C appendage that provides both a dependable10/100 Fast Ethernet connection and two USB- A anchorages forperipherals.However, you might add a USB keyboard and mouse to get PC- suchlike functionality out of your tablet, If the appendage is for particularuse.However, you might connect a barcode scanner and damage printer, If the mobile device is being used in a pavilion setup or as a POS outstation. 

OTG appendages do n’t bear external power as the mobile device can actually power the appendage and the connected peripherals. For OTG, it’s the data connection that’s a necessity, not power. In fact, the quantum of power a mobile device can deliver in OTG mode is limited. 

still, you may need a powered USB mecca, If the peripherals bear further power than the device is able of. Powered USB capitals come with their own power inventories and so do n’t use the mobile device’s battery. The mecca would connect to the OTG appendage through USB. The appendage, in turn, would be connected to the mobile device through its USB- C or Micro USB power harborage. Any fresh peripherals would also be connected to the powered mecca rather of the appendage. The mobile device still remains in OTG mode. It's still USB Host and can still communicate with the peripherals through the appendage. still, the powered USB mecca is what's actually powering them, not the mobile device.
